Robert Kiyosaki Warns of the Future of the US Dollar, Suggesting Crypto and Precious Metals as Safe Havens

Renowned author Robert Kiyosaki issued a warning about the future of the U.S. dollar on social media. He suggests that cryptocurrencies and precious metals like Bitcoin, gold, and silver signal potential problems within the current financial system. His message highlights concerns held by many individuals and institutions regarding the US dollar’s stability.
